.lpc-features-2 {
	padding: 32px 0; 
}

[data-media-source="media-xs"] .lpc-features-2, [data-media-source="media-sm"] .lpc-features-2 {
	padding: 24px 0; 
}

.lpc-features-2__title + * {
	margin-top: 28px;
}

[data-media-source="media-xs"] .lpc-features-2__title + * , [data-media-source="media-sm"] .lpc-features-2__title + * {
	margin-top: 20px;
}

.lpc-features-2__header {
	margin-bottom: 32px;
}

[data-media-source="media-xs"] .lpc-features-2__header, 
[data-media-source="media-sm"] .lpc-features-2__header {
	margin-bottom: 24px;
}

.lpc-features-2__item-content {
	border: 1px solid var(--text-color-a-01);
	width: 100%;
	display:  flex;
	flex-direction: column;
}

.lpc-features-2__item-content._a_i_center {
	text-align: center;
}

.lpc-features-2__item-content._a_i_center .lpc-features-2__item-image {
	align-self: center;
}

.lpc-features-2__item-content > div:last-child,
.lpc-features-2__item-holder > div:last-child {
	margin-bottom: 0;
}

[data-media-source="media-xl"] .lpc-features-2 .lpc-features-2__items {
	margin-bottom: -30px;
}
[data-media-source="media-lg"] .lpc-features-2 .lpc-features-2__items {
	margin-bottom: -32px;
}
[data-media-source="media-md"] .lpc-features-2 .lpc-features-2__items {
	margin-bottom: -24px;
}
[data-media-source="media-sm"] .lpc-features-2 .lpc-features-2__items {
	margin-bottom: -16px;
}
[data-media-source="media-xs"] .lpc-features-2 .lpc-features-2__items {
	margin-bottom: -16px;
}

.lpc-features-2__items._left {
	justify-content: flex-start;
}
.lpc-features-2__items._center {
	justify-content: center;
}
.lpc-features-2__items._right {
	justify-content: flex-end;
}

.lpc-features-2__item {
	display: flex;
	margin-bottom: 40px;
}
[data-media-source="media-lg"] .lpc-features-2__item {
	margin-bottom: 32px;
}
[data-media-source="media-md"] .lpc-features-2__item {
	margin-bottom: 24px;
}
[data-media-source="media-sm"] .lpc-features-2__item {
	margin-bottom: 16px;
}
[data-media-source="media-xs"] .lpc-features-2__item {
	margin-bottom: 16px;
}

.lpc-features-2__item-image {
	margin-bottom: 16px;
	max-width: 180px;
	max-height: 180px;
	border-radius: 50%;
	background: var(--primary-color-l-35);
	display: flex;
	align-items: center;
	justify-content: center;
	overflow: hidden;
	padding: 16px;
	align-self: flex-start;
}

[data-media-source="media-sm"] .lpc-features-2__item-image, 
[data-media-source="media-xs"] .lpc-features-2__item-image {
	padding: 12px;
}

.lpc-features-2__image {
	font-size: 0;
	overflow: hidden;
	max-width: 100%;
	max-height: 100%;
	width: 48px;
	height: 48px;
    display: flex;
    align-items: center;
    justify-content: center;
}

.lpc-features-2__image svg {
	fill: var(--primary-color-base);
	max-width: 100%;
	max-height: 100%;
}

.lpc-features-2__image img {
	width: 100%;
	height: 100%;
	object-fit: contain;
}

[data-media-source="media-sm"] .lpc-features-2__item-image, [data-media-source="media-xs"] .lpc-features-2__item-image {
	margin-bottom: 12px;
}

.lpc-features-2__item-subtitle {
	margin-bottom: 16px;
}

[data-media-source="media-xs"] .lpc-features-2__item-subtitle {
	margin-bottom: 12px;
}

[data-media-source="media-xl"] .lpc-features-2__item.two_columns .lpc-features-2__item-content {
	padding: 36px;
}
[data-media-source="media-lg"] .lpc-features-2__item.two_columns .lpc-features-2__item-content {
	padding: 32px;
}
[data-media-source="media-md"] .lpc-features-2__item.two_columns .lpc-features-2__item-content {
	padding: 28px;
}
[data-media-source="media-sm"] .lpc-features-2__item.two_columns .lpc-features-2__item-content {
	padding: 24px;
}
[data-media-source="media-xs"] .lpc-features-2__item.two_columns .lpc-features-2__item-content {
	padding: 20px;
}


[data-media-source="media-xl"] .lpc-features-2__item.three_columns .lpc-features-2__item-content {
	padding: 36px;
}
[data-media-source="media-lg"] .lpc-features-2__item.three_columns .lpc-features-2__item-content {
	padding: 32px;
}
[data-media-source="media-md"] .lpc-features-2__item.three_columns .lpc-features-2__item-content {
	padding: 28px;
}
[data-media-source="media-sm"] .lpc-features-2__item.three_columns .lpc-features-2__item-content {
	padding: 24px;
}
[data-media-source="media-xs"] .lpc-features-2__item.three_columns .lpc-features-2__item-content {
	padding: 20px;
}


[data-media-source="media-xl"] .lpc-features-2__item.four_columns .lpc-features-2__item-content {
	padding: 28px;
}
[data-media-source="media-lg"] .lpc-features-2__item.four_columns .lpc-features-2__item-content {
	padding: 28px;
}
[data-media-source="media-md"] .lpc-features-2__item.four_columns .lpc-features-2__item-content {
	padding: 28px;
}
[data-media-source="media-sm"] .lpc-features-2__item.four_columns .lpc-features-2__item-content {
	padding: 24px;
}
[data-media-source="media-xs"] .lpc-features-2__item.four_columns .lpc-features-2__item-content {
	padding: 20px;
}